Description

The public relations (PR) as well as marketing coordinators responsible for managing public relations and marketing initiatives for their companies. They manage communications with customers and vendors to boost brand recognition and among their primary tasks is to collaborate with their colleagues on marketing materials which increase brand recognition and sales. Marketing and PR coordinators ensure that deadlines are met and maintain relationships with external partners. They establish business relationships in an efforts to improve the brand's popularity and profitability and aid in the design and implementation of successful marketing campaigns.

Marketing and PR coordinators handle outbound direct response tasks such as responding to e-mails and correspondence on websites. They also create comprehensive reports to ensure transparency for clients and supervise print communications to ensure the accuracy of their work and to ensure that procedures are in compliance. Marketing and PR coordinators generally utilize personal computers as their primary tools for creating statements on public relations, marketing materials, and to send emails to colleagues as well as prospective/current customers. They usually report their developments to their supervisors directly usually the marketing or public relations director in their company or department.

An undergraduate degree from communications, public relations or another related field is required for this job. Experience in a similar job or in a similar field could be preferable. Marketing and PR coordinators should be focused on results and pay close attention to detail, and possess excellent written and oral communication abilities. Additionally, they must be extremely organized, possess an understanding of various methods of marketing, as well as be able to work effectively both independently and within a team.

Roles & Responsibilities

As a Public Relations PR and Marketing Coordinator with 0-3 years of experience in the United Kingdom, your main responsibilities are:

  • Develop and implement communications strategies to enhance brand awareness and promote the organization's products or services.This includes creating engaging content, managing social media channels, and coordinating press releases.
  • Support the coordination of marketing campaigns, including conducting market research, identifying target audiences, and monitoring campaign performance.You will assist in executing marketing initiatives, analyzing data, and providing insights for future campaigns.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ure consistent messaging and branding across all communication channels.This involves working closely with the PR, marketing, and creative teams to align strategies and maintain brand reputation.
  • Assist in organizing and managing events, such as trade shows, product launches, and corporate gatherings.

Career Prospects

The Public Relations PR and Marketing Coordinator role is crucial for effective communication and strategic marketing. For individuals with 0-3 years of experience in the United Kingdom, here are following alternative roles to consider:

  • Social Media Specialist: A position focused on managing and growing social media platforms, creating engaging content, and monitoring online campaigns.
  • Content Writer: A role that involves creating compelling and persuasive content for various marketing channels, including blogs, websites, and promotional materials.
  • Event Coordinator: A position responsible for planning and executing marketing events, such as conferences, trade shows, and product launches.
  • Digital Marketing Assistant: A role that supports digital marketing strategies, including search engine optimization SEO, email marketing, and online advertising campaigns.
